Samsung Develops AI to Detect Early Alzheimer’s Signs Through Everyday Data

Samsung announced that it’s research department has made progress in identifying early warning signs of Alzheimer’s disease by analyzing data collected from users’ daily routines.

Researchers at Samsung Research have developed “biometric markers” capable of measuring cognitive decline - a key early indicator of Alzheimer’s – by analyzing mobile phone usage patterns.this includes metrics like typing speed and the frequency with which users rely on auto-correct features. The study suggests that subtle changes in these behaviors can signal emerging cognitive issues.
A separate study combined data from mobile phones and smartwatches to detect cognitive decline. Researchers measured users’ walking speed, step length, and balance, finding correlations between changes in these metrics and potential cognitive impairment.
Samsung reports that the accuracy of these methods is comparable to that of traditional dementia investigations conducted in hospital settings.However, the company has not yet announced a timeline for integrating these technologies into publicly available Galaxy mobile devices and smartwatches.
Understanding the Significance of Early Detection
Alzheimer’s disease is a progressive neurodegenerative disorder that affects millions worldwide. according to the Alzheimer’s Association, more then 6.7 million Americans are living with Alzheimer’s in 2024. Early detection is crucial because it allows for earlier intervention with available treatments and lifestyle adjustments, possibly slowing the progression of the disease and improving quality of life.
Currently, diagnosis often relies on subjective assessments and can be delayed until symptoms are pronounced. Samsung’s research aims to provide a more objective and proactive approach to identifying individuals at risk, potentially years before clinical symptoms manifest.
How Samsung’s Technology Works
The core of Samsung’s approach lies in leveraging the vast amounts of data generated by everyday smartphone and smartwatch use. Here’s a breakdown of the key methods:
Mobile Phone Data Analysis
- Typing Speed: A decline in typing speed can indicate cognitive slowing.
- Auto-Correct Usage: Increased reliance on auto-correct may suggest difficulties with word retrieval and language processing.
- App Usage Patterns: Changes in the frequency or type of apps used could signal shifts in cognitive function.
Wearable Sensor Data Analysis
- Walking Speed: Reduced walking speed is frequently enough an early sign of cognitive impairment.
- Step Length: Shorter step lengths can indicate difficulties with motor control and coordination.
- balance: Impaired balance can be a precursor to falls and may be linked to cognitive decline.
